Output d1733ebd457181bf5ac21a5ae38280a6e50fb9d31a3ac0b1959fffe043c91087:0

value
3039024803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768aea36fc6a6c2f88ca731fc8da9fb5fb55e7bb OP_EQUAL
address
MJhxP3S3qwWZdHAhxDPqpbtNXSKrdCjuqW
transaction
d1733ebd457181bf5ac21a5ae38280a6e50fb9d31a3ac0b1959fffe043c91087
spent
true